Act Three is possibly the most expansive of the three Acts that startPath of Exile 2, with a wide range of complex boss fights, areas, and things to find. Many of theseboss fights are optional, while certain ones will need to be completed to complete the Act.
The Queen of Filth is one of the Act Three bosses, and she’s capable of dealing a considerable amount of damage in a short amount of time. On top of that, she’s capable of summoning minions to her aid during the fight, making the smaller safe area on the ground around her that much smaller.

Where To Find The Queen Of Filth
The Queen of Filth is found in the first half of Act Three,in the Apex of Filth, which is an areafound in The Drowned City. The Apex of Filth is full of minions you’ll need to fight through before you get to the Queen, located on the opposite side of the area from where you enter.
Preparing For The Queen Of Filth
The primary concern in the Queen of Filth fight is the small area in which the fight takes place, combined withall the ground effects that she disperses constantly throughout the fight. It can be difficult to reliably maneuver around the area, dodging her attacks without dodging directly into a ground effect can be a challenge.
Every Queen Of Filth Attack
The Queen of Filth has quite a few attacks, and understanding what she’s about to do the moment before she does it can be the difference between life and death.
How To Avoid
Flatten
The Queen of Filth will say ‘flatten’ before she attempts to, in fact,flatten you with her hammer. This one is easily enough avoided bydodging in any direction other than directly in front of her.
To Your Queen
She’ll yell ‘to your Queen’ or ‘brethren, to me’ fairly often,summoning a small horde of minions to herfrom the only entrance to the small arena that you’re fighting in. There’s no avoiding this, so try to just get into a position where you can handle a bigger fight.
Tenderize
This attack has herslam her hammer once, then flip over the hammer and slam again. The spot where she flips is going to become a ground hazard, causing medium damage if you stand inside.Dodge to the side to avoid this, and be careful not to leap right into it afterward.
Grind You Up
This is one of her easier attacks to avoid; with this, she justswings a hand sideways, and then slams her hammer straight into the groundin front of her. There is a bigger area of effect (AoE) on this than usual, so justdodge further away with this than you would Flatten.
Rot
This is a less usual attack, but she’s still going to do it a few times throughout the fight. Here,she creates another ground effect in a circle; these can have varying effects, all eitherdebuffing you in a myriad of ways or dealing a different type of damagewhile you’re inside. Avoid taking the risk of standing inside one to deal some damage to her.
Ground Explosions
Throughout the fight, orange,burning chunks of ground are going to form lines across the small arena. Without much warning,she’ll detonate these in a linestarting from her. They will alsodetonate if you stand on top of them. If you need to cross these lines, dodge over them horizontally and quickly, to lessen the chance of her doing this while you’re on them.
Tips For Defeating The Queen Of Filth
Certain bosses you might need totweak your builda little bit in order to get over the finish line; that isn’t usually the case with the Queen of Filth. Shedoes not have any particularly difficult attacks to avoid, nor does she have any especially complex or difficult mechanics.
Watch Your Footing
The most important thing when dealing with the Queen of Filth is towatch your footing. More than half of the area is going to be covered with a negative effect for large portions of the fight, and accidentally standing inside one is a good way to find yourself restarting the fight.
Attack only when you can safely do so. Approach the fight with patience, and don’t take the unnecessary risk of AoE damage that’s easily avoided. These different AoE’s can compound at the same time and take you from full health to dead immediately.

Deal With Her Minions Quickly
When shesummons her minions, it’seasy to fall into the trap of trying to ignore themif you have a chance at dealing damage to her. If the floor wasn’t covered in damaging effects, this wouldn’t be as harmful.
But, because so much footing is covered in negative effects, the minions are going to fill the space around you that likely isn’t, further reducing your ability to move, and damaging you all the while.Take a couple of seconds to deal with them, while keeping an eye on the Queen of Filth’s attacks.
